In recent decades, authors affiliated with Shandong Iron and Steel Group (China) have published 943 papers, which have received a total of 7.2k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 548 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 302 papers in Materials Chemistry and 260 papers in Mechanics of Materials on the topics of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Steels (223 papers),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(199 papers) and Metallurgy and Material Forming (141 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Mechanical Engineering (4.5k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.5k citations) and Mechanics of Materials (1.8k citations). Authors at Shandong Iron and Steel Group (China) collaborate with scholars in China, Australia and United States and have published in prestigious journals including The Lancet,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ews. Some of Shandong Iron and Steel Group (China)'s most productive authors include Lifeng Zhang, Weihua Sun, Wen Yang, Wenzheng Zhai, Zengshi Xu, Jie Yao, Yufu Wang, Mang Wang, Liang Dong and Jiajie Li.
